Start digests only when your calendar shows consecutive meetings, defer summaries during travel, and activate reminders when you connect to home Wi-Fi. Combine weekday filters, time zones, and work calendars to act appropriately, preventing noisy actions when you most need quiet or rest.
Include quick reactions after each run, such as helpful or not, and a dropdown for why. Use that signal to tighten filters, change timing, or add missing context. Over time, your automations reflect preferences without demanding heavy configuration or risky, opaque machine learning.
Set daily caps for repetitive actions, require human approval for deletions, and add fallback steps when a service is down. Weekly reviews catch drift, while alerts summarize anomalies. By rehearsing failure, you build trust that the system protects priorities under pressure.
